Higher Education Project Manager (Licensed Architect)
Location: Dallas or San Antonio (Hybrid/Flexible)
A nationally recognized architecture and design firm is seeking a Higher Education Project Manager to join its growing education practice. This role offers the opportunity to lead complex academic projects for colleges and universities while collaborating with a multidisciplinary, design‑driven team.
The Opportunity
This position is ideal for a Licensed Architect who thrives in a client‑facing leadership role and has experience managing higher education projects from concept through construction. The firm is known for large‑scale, technically sophisticated academic work and a strong commitment to design excellence, research, and user experience.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ead Higher Education projects through all phases of design and delivery
- Manage project scope, schedule, budget, and consultant coordination
- Serve as the primary point of contact for institutional clients and stakeholders
- Guide and mentor project teams, ensuring quality and consistency across deliverables
- Oversee technical documentation and ensure compliance with applicable codes and standards
- Collaborate closely with internal design, planning, and engineering partners
Qualifications
- Licensed Architect (required)
- Bachelor's or Master's degree in Architecture
- 8+ years of professional experience, with a strong focus on Higher Education projects
- Proven experience managing complex academic facilities (academic buildings, student centers, STEM, labs, or similar)
- Strong knowledge of construction documents, consultant coordination, and project delivery methods
- Proficiency in Revit and familiarity with industry‑standard tools
- Excellent communication, leadership, and client engagement skills
